1. Defining Your Brand Identity: The Foundation of Success

Your brand identity is the heart and soul of your business. It’s what makes you unique, memorable, and relatable to your target audience. It’s more than just a logo; it encompasses your values, mission, personality, and overall message.

  • Identify Your Target Audience: Who are you trying to reach? Understanding your ideal customer’s demographics, interests, and needs is fundamental. Use WordPress plugins like Google Analytics to track website traffic and gain valuable insights into your audience.
  • Craft Your Brand Story: What makes your business special? Why should people choose you over your competitors? Develop a compelling narrative that connects with your target audience on an emotional level.
  • Define Your Brand Values: What principles guide your business? These values should be reflected in everything you do, from your website content to your customer service.
  • Choose a Memorable Name and Logo: Your brand name and logo should be instantly recognizable and evoke the right emotions. Use a WordPress theme that allows for easy customization of your logo and branding elements.

2. Building a Strong Market Position: Differentiating Yourself

Once you’ve defined your brand identity, it’s time to establish your market position. This involves understanding your competitors and finding ways to differentiate yourself.

  • Conduct a Competitive Analysis: Who are your main competitors? What are their strengths and weaknesses? What are their pricing strategies and marketing tactics? Use WordPress tools like SEO Yoast to analyze your competitors’ websites and identify opportunities.
  • Identify Your Unique Selling Proposition (USP): What makes you stand out from the crowd? What value do you offer that your competitors don’t? This could be a unique product, exceptional customer service, or a competitive pricing strategy.
  • Focus on Your Target Market: Don’t try to be everything to everyone. Instead, focus your marketing efforts on your ideal customer. Use WordPress plugins like WooCommerce to target specific customer segments with tailored product recommendations and promotions.

3. Optimizing Your WordPress Website for Brand Identity and Market Position

Your website is your primary platform for showcasing your brand identity and communicating your market position.

  • Choose a Professional WordPress Theme: Select a theme that aligns with your brand identity and offers the necessary features for your business. Consider themes like Astra or Divi for their flexibility and customization options.
  • Optimize Your Website Content: Use high-quality content that is informative, engaging, and relevant to your target audience. Use WordPress plugins like Yoast SEO to optimize your content for search engines and improve your website’s visibility.
  • Use High-Quality Images and Videos: Visuals play a crucial role in brand building. Use high-resolution images and videos that are consistent with your brand identity and appeal to your target audience.
  • Integrate Social Media: Connect your WordPress website with your social media profiles to build brand awareness and engage with your audience. Use WordPress plugins like Jetpack to streamline social media integration.

4. Building Trust and Credibility: The Cornerstone of Success

Trust and credibility are essential for building a successful brand.

  • Provide Excellent Customer Service: Go the extra mile to ensure customer satisfaction. Use WordPress plugins like WPForms to create contact forms and streamline communication.
  • Build a Strong Online Reputation: Encourage customer reviews and testimonials on your website. Use WordPress plugins like WP Customer Reviews to showcase positive feedback.
  • Be Transparent and Authentic: Be honest about your products and services, and don’t be afraid to show your personality.
  • Stay Consistent: Maintain a consistent brand message across all your platforms. This includes your website, social media, and marketing materials.

5. Measuring and Refining Your Brand Identity and Market Position

It’s essential to track your progress and make adjustments as needed.

  • Monitor Your Website Analytics: Use Google Analytics to track website traffic, user behavior, and conversion rates.
  • Track Social Media Engagement: Monitor your social media metrics to gauge audience engagement and identify areas for improvement.
  • Conduct Customer Surveys: Gather feedback from your customers to understand their needs and perceptions of your brand.
  • Stay Updated with Industry Trends: Keep an eye on the latest trends in your industry and adjust your brand identity and marketing strategies accordingly.
